Document the status for all problems in the plan of care and identify them as stable, worsening, or progressing (mild or severe), when applicable; do not assume that the auditor or coder can infer this from the documentation details. OIG negotiates corporate integrity agreements (CIA) with health care providers and other entities as part of the settlement of Federal health care program investigations arising under a variety of civil false claims statutes. 0000004767 00000 n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ders Exit Disclaimer: You Are Leaving www.ihs.gov, Evaluation and Management: consultation.
